CON: Comparator Enable bit
1 = Comparator is enabled
0 = Comparator is disabled
COE: Comparator Output Enable bit
1 = Comparator output is present on the CxOUT pin (assigned in the PPS module)
0 = Comparator output is internal only
CPOL: Comparator Output Polarity Select bit
1 = Comparator output is inverted
0 = Comparator output is not inverted
EVPOL<1:0>: Interrupt Polarity Select bits
11 = Interrupt generation on any change of the output
10 = Interrupt generation only on high-to-low transition of the output
01 = Interrupt generation only on low-to-high transition of the output
00 = Interrupt generation is disabled
CREF: Comparator Reference Select bit (non-inverting input)
1 = Non-inverting input connects to the internal CV
0 = Non-inverting input connects to the CxINA pin
CCH<1:0>: Comparator Channel Select bits
11 = Inverting input of comparator connects to V
10 = Inverting input of comparator connects to the CxIND pin
01 = Inverting input of comparator connects to the CxINC pin
00 = Inverting input of comparator connects to the CxINB pin
